How it works

So, how do these two tools actually work together? Malwarebytes is a standalone anti-malware program that detects and removes malware, including adware, spyware, and Trojans. Windows Defender, on the other hand, is a built-in Windows operating system that offers real-time protection against viruses, spyware, and other malware. When used together, Malwarebytes and Windows Defender can complement each other's strengths and weaknesses. For example, Malwarebytes can detect and remove malware that Windows Defender may have missed, and vice versa.

Can I run Malwarebytes and Windows Defender at the same time?

Yes, you can run both Malwarebytes and Windows Defender simultaneously. In fact, they're designed to work together to provide optimal protection. However, it's worth noting that running multiple anti-malware tools can sometimes cause conflicts or slowdowns, so use with caution.

Will Malwarebytes conflict with Windows Defender?

Generally, no. Malwarebytes and Windows Defender are designed to work together, and conflicts are rare. However, if you're running multiple anti-malware tools, there's a small chance of conflicts. Be sure to keep your operating system and software up to date to minimize the risk.

Can Malwarebytes and Windows Defender detect all types of malware?

No, no security tool can detect 100% of malware. Malware is constantly evolving, and new threats are emerging all the time. However, when used together, Malwarebytes and Windows Defender can detect and remove a wide range of malware types.

Is Malwarebytes a replacement for Windows Defender?

No, Malwarebytes is not a replacement for Windows Defender. While Malwarebytes can detect and remove malware, Windows Defender provides real-time protection against viruses, spyware, and other malware. Use both tools together for comprehensive protection.
